dc.description.abstractIn this study, the decomposition method for the approximate solutions of the linear and nonlinear deterministic or stochastic differential equations, is given by the decomposition (Adomian) and has been investigated in general. In applying the method to the nonlinear deterministic hyperbolic equations, the concept of the Adomian polynomials has been explained and one application of the method given for the general state is obtained.
